    Ast cards now: Royal road/minor arcana ewer or spire, maybe use ewer on a healer that died if you have it for fodder.
    Maybe use a spire on a dps in dungeons for aoe.

    Fishing for spear for monks and bards and balance for everybody, arrow could go on the caster in case you get nothing else. But what everybody wants is balance since balance is the best anyways.

    Repeat.
    Get bad cards and just minor arcana them since you can't do anything else with ewers and spires other than royal road but it's already on aoe.

    But the decisions of maybe spreading a bole is gone, oh no, just use aspected helios in shield and or use the bubble, the bubble is amazing, asts don't use the bubble, why not use bubble, bubble nice, bubble friend.
    The ability to help a res'ed healer is gone but what ast usually holds anything but an balance/spear or maybe pity arrow?

    Ast cards in shadowbringers:
    Still rng, but now ranged and melee are seperated. Each has 3 cards, each different card has a different seal. ALL are balances, all have the same effect
    YOu want to fish for the buff your team needs depending on what class they are(don't forget that it will take more time in 8player content) to get 3 seals to use divination for an extra buff, repeat.

    What you lose: Aoe, bole, tp/mp management tools that 90% aren't used since the ewer/spire got foddered off already for minor arcana or royal road.


    Also, bards procs will not be dependant on crit anymore, they don't need spears anymore.

    And you can't tell me that your tank loves getting a bole after an aoe balance because they apparently can't have it. ANd that it's really needed.
    It's just a nice tool to have but the actual usability of it is niche at best.
